Sourcing guidance for Decorative Tassel Fringe

How to evaluate the material quality and durability of Decorative Tassel Fringe?

When sourcing tassel fringe, the material composition directly impacts the luster, drape, and longevity. For high-end upholstery, prioritize Rayon or Viscose for a silky sheen and superior drape. For outdoor or high-traffic use, Polyester or Nylon is preferred due to its abrasion resistance and colorfastness. Ensure the supplier provides a rub count test report and verify that the header (the woven top part) is tightly bound to prevent unraveling during sewing or daily use.

What are the key compliance and safety standards for textile trimmings in international trade?

Compliance is critical to avoid customs seizures. Ensure the products meet OEKO-TEX® Standard 100, which guarantees the absence of harmful substances. For the US market, products must comply with CPSIA lead and phthalate limits, especially if used on children's items. For the EU, ensure adherence to REACH regulations. Always request a Certificate of Compliance (CoC) and verify that the dyes used are AZO-free to meet global health standards.

How can I ensure color consistency across different production batches?

Color variance (dye lot difference) is a common issue in textile sourcing. To mitigate this, require the supplier to use Pantone TPX/TCX color codes rather than just photos. For large orders, insist on a Lab Dip approval process before mass production. Professional suppliers on Made-in-China.com often use spectrophotometers to ensure the Delta E (color difference) remains below 1.0, ensuring consistency between the sample and the bulk shipment.

What functional specifications should be considered for different usage scenarios?

The application dictates the technical requirements. For curtains and drapery, the fringe must have a UV-resistant coating to prevent fading from sunlight. For apparel and fashion, ensure the fringe is washable (shrinkage <3%) and dry-clean friendly. For lampshades or contract hospitality projects, it is essential to specify Flame Retardant (FR) treatments that meet NFPA 701 or BS 5852 standards.

Cross-Border Procurement Risks and Strategic Advice

How to mitigate the risk of receiving poor-quality goods in bulk?

Never skip the Pre-Shipment Inspection (PSI). Hire a third-party agency to perform an AQL 2.5/4.0 inspection. Focus on checking the tassel density (strands per inch), total length accuracy, and the presence of weaving defects. What are the best strategies for negotiating with fringe manufacturers?

Negotiation should focus on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) rather than just the unit price. Ask for tiered pricing (e.g., 500m, 2000m, 5000m) to understand the supplier's margin. Negotiate for free replacement of defective units (usually a 1-3% defect allowance is standard). If you are a repeat buyer, request flexible payment terms such as Net 30 or a lower deposit (e.g., 20% instead of 30%) to improve your cash flow.

What should be considered regarding international shipping and packaging for tassels?

Tassels are prone to tangling and crushing during long-transit sea freight. Insist that the fringe be wound on sturdy cardboard spools and wrapped in protective polybags to prevent moisture absorption. For shipping to the US or Europe, compare FOB vs. DDP terms; DDP is often more convenient for smaller B2B buyers as the supplier handles all customs clearance and import duties, providing a landed cost.
